Blackfinch Group is bringing the future to financial advisers in tax‑advantaged products, asset management and employee benefits. Our BDMs connect advisers with our award‑winning ventures and asset managers through strong local relationships, and make complex concepts seem simple and effective. We’re looking for an ambitious Senior / Executive Business Development Manager in the North West England area who brings energy, ownership, and a genuine passion for building relationships. This is a role for someone who enjoys opening new doors, growing existing partnerships, and delivering real commercial impact.
Key Responsibilities
- Winning new adviser firms and establishing Blackfinch as a trusted partner
- Expanding relationships within existing firms — increasing engagement, product use, and value
- Protecting and strengthening partnerships through consistent, high‑quality service
This is a role where activity matters, but impact matters more. Every conversation, meeting, and interaction should move relationships forward.
What makes this role different
- You’ll represent a broad, high‑quality product range across tax and asset management
- You’ll have the autonomy to run your territory like a business
- You’ll be part of a team that values collaboration, energy, and continuous improvement
Skills & Experience
This role is as much about attitude and behaviours as it is about experience. We’re looking for someone who is:
- Proactive and driven – you don’t wait for opportunities, you create them
- Commercially sharp – you understand what drives growth and act on it
- Relationship‑led – you build trust quickly and maintain it over time
- Disciplined and organised – you manage your time, pipeline, and data effectively
- Resilient and consistent – you deliver, even when it’s challenging
- Curious and thoughtful – you seek to understand advisers and add real value
Your experience
- Proven success in business development within financial services (tax planning / asset management preferred)
- Strong track record of hitting and exceeding targets
- Experience building both new and existing adviser relationships
- Confidence engaging with larger firms and senior stakeholders
Essential Qualifications & Requirements
- A qualification level knowledge of IHT, EIS, VCT and CMS and the tax impacts of each.
- Either holds or is currently working towards or willing to work towards Chartered status in Financial Services or equivalent.
